- Did you mean
- 600a water 206mm 2
- 600a wier 20amp 2
- Related search terms
- water part good 150
- water part good 15
- water part good 145
- water part good 1000
- water part good 10am
-
IDOL 220XL T£6,995.00
Items 25-25 of 25
Items 25-25 of 25
